Snow Predicted Friday Afternoon

The National Weather Service says there is an 80 percent chance of flakes after 3 p.m.

 

 

For the second time this week, the National Weather Service (NWS) is predicting snow for Prince George's County. 

According to the forecast, there is an 80 percent chance that flakes will fall sometime after 3 p.m., with accumulations up to one inch. The snow is predicted to continue in the evening, slowing by 10 p.m., blanketing the area with up to another half inch.

Sunny skies and temperatures in the mid 30s are predicted for Saturday and Sunday.
